Sarai wrapped a soccer

ball in a box in the shape of a square

pyramid. The box has a base with

sides 12 inches and a slant height of

20 inches. How many square inches of

cardboard were used to make the box?

Respuesta :

Answer:

624 square inches of  cardboard were used to make the box.

Step-by-step explanation:

Slant height of the box = l = 20 inches

Side of the base of the box = s = 12 inch

Area of the base = [tex]s^2[/tex]

Area of triangular face = [tex]\frac{1}{2}\times s\time l[/tex]

There are 4 triangle faces, and single square base , so the total area is :

[tex]T=s^2+4\times \frac{1}{2}s\times h[/tex]

[tex]=(12 inch)^2+4\times \frac{1}{2}\times 12 inch\times 20 inch[/tex]

[tex]T=624 inch^2[/tex]

624 square inches of  cardboard were used to make the box.
